Livingstons Billards appears in inspection records eight times, starting in 2023. The most recent visit was on Jan 14, 2026.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.

Recent visits have produced comparable findings, with counts hovering near two violations per visit.

Across the inspection history, “ice buildup in reach-in freezer” is the issue that surfaces most often, recorded three times.

That falls roughly in the middle of the pack for Bradenton restaurants. The record reflects steady performance over time.

High Priority - Stop Sale issued on time/temperature control for safety food due to temperature abuse. Observed in Reach in cooler at Pizza Make Station Cooked Beef Taco (51F - Cooling). Person in charge stated that it was placed in the Walk in cooler on 3/13/24. Educated Person in charge on cooling procedures for Cooked/heated time/temperature control for safety food and emailed Person in charge a copy of the handout. Person in charge voluntarily discarded the Taco meat.
01B-02-5
High Priority - Cooked/heated time/temperature control for safety food not cooled from 135 degrees Fahrenheit to 41 degrees Fahrenheit within 6 hours. Observed in Reach in cooler at Pizza Make Station Cooked Beef Taco (51F - Cooling). Person in charge stated that it was placed in the Walk in cooler on 3/13/24. Educated Person in charge on cooling procedures for Cooked/heated time/temperature control for safety food and emailed Person in charge a copy of the handout. Person in charge voluntarily discarded the Taco meat. **Corrected On-Site**
